Letter from a supplier discussing a quotation for metal pedal and stem components.

Identifier  ExFiles\Box 147\5\  scan0217
Date  18th May 1934
  
B. G.{Mr Griffiths - Chief Accountant / Mr Gnapp} R.{Sir Henry Royce} Co., LTD. CONTINUATION NO. 1.

Messrs. Rolls-Royce Ltd.,
Derby.

May 18th 1934.

Delivery could commence in approximately three to four weeks from receipt of your order, and continue at the rate of 150/200 per week.

The question was raised as to whether we could supply the complete article, including the metal pedal and stem. This we could certainly do if required, but we should need drawings of the steel part to enable us to circulate enquiries to our suppliers. On the other hand we are inclined to think that it would hardly be the most economical arrangement because you will command at least equal and probably better terms for steel parts of this description.

As a suggestion we would like to mention the possibility of employing a detachable metal head to the steel stems, which would obviate the necessity of sending the complete article to us. You are, we believe, familiar with these detachable pedal heads, and if the idea meets with your approval perhaps you could submit another sample or drawing, and we would revise this quotation accordingly.

We are very interested in your requirements, and shall be only too pleased to go further into the matter when we have heard from you.

Yours faithfully,
BRITISH GOODRICH RUBBER CO.LTD.

[Illegible Signature]
Manager - Northern Mechanical Dept.
